Growlithe (Japanese: ガーディ Gardie) is a Fire-type Basic Pokémon card. It is part of the Aquapolis expansion.

e-Reader data

This card has two prints: both have the card ID C-09-#. The short strip contains Pokédex information, a brief card summary, and information on the content of the long strip.

Release information

In Japan, this card was reprinted with artwork by the same artist as part of a McDonald's promotion that ran between May 25 and June 16, 2002.

Trivia

Origin

Ember is a move in the Pokémon games that Growlithe can learn. This card's English e-Reader Pokédex entry comes from Pokémon Crystal, whereas the Japanese entry comes from Pokémon Gold.
